Star Struck Episodes 5 & 6: Release Date, Preview & Streaming Guide
The new episode of Star Struck is coming soon. Star Struck is a short Korean Bl series that began airing on May 18, 2023. Following the global success of the Thai and Japanese Bl series, Korean drama ...